KREMEN Реклама
KREMEN Реклама

Управление печатью по сети (wifi). Изучение хотелок населения

mmasco
Идет загрузка
Загрузка
01.03.2021
808
18
Вопросы и ответы

Управление печатью по сети (wifi). Изучение хотелок населения

Рукожоплю тут wifi модуль ориентированный на голый MKS xGEN L (или любую RAMPS), делаю на Wemos D1 mini, т.е. на готовой платке с минимумом пайки. Основная функция - сетевой диск с доступом по webdav и наверное по ftp, чтобы сливать на него файлы с максимально возможной для ESP скоростью. Подключатся будет по spi (разьем mks aux3) и uart (разьем aux1 на mks genl или wifi на mks tft). Со стороны прошивки принтера он будет виден как штатный SD RAMPS модуль. В качестве бонуса модуль будет еще и издавать звуки т.е. работать в качестве штатного динамика RAMPS, а то на aux3 один порт пропадает, а я, сцуко, хозяйственный.

Собственно вопрос (или опрос)  к народу будет по поводу прошивки для данной вундервафли. Различных ESPwebDAV прошивок на гите овердохрена, тут ничего нового я не предложу, ну разве что работать будет чуть побыстрей и постабильней. Но все они без возможности упраления принтером, поэтому прошивка у меня будет своя собственная, с преферансом и гимназистками. Вот по поводу гимназисток, т.е. управления и вопрос. Что бы для вас было бы удобнее и практичнее:

1. Примитивное управление через тот же webdav или ftp, типа несколько команд: отправить на печать файл, пауза, продолжить, остановить нахрен. Т.е. не плодим лишние сущности и управляем через  тот же эксплорер или файлменеджер которым заливали файлы, как говорится - не отходя от кассы. Работать будет откуда угодно где можно подцепиться к webdav или ftp принтера, т.е. с компа, сотового, телевизора, умного утюга или холодильника. 

2. Отдельный прозрачный мост tcp-uart, т.е. полное управление через какой-нить pronterface или курицу с сетевым com портом.

3. Отдельный веб сервер с минимальным набором команд и примитивной статистикой.

Сложность реализации пропорциональна номеру варианта. Как по мне, так 1 вариант оптимален, хочется помедитировать на прогресс и  графики - подойдите к экрану принтера... Но может быть у вас другое мнение и вы можете его аргументировать, или вообще другой вариант решения - я бы с удовольствием с ними ознакомился. Заранее благодарю.

 

Ответы на вопросы